Picture of the day - April 21, 2007
Tree And Horse Beside The Virginia Creeper Trail

Yesterday evening just before sundown, Cheria, Tami and I took a
leisurely walk on the
Virginia Creeper Trail in order to try out Cheria's new Canon
Powershot S3 IS digital camera. We had enjoyed a very nice, sunny day
for a change in the Abingdon area, and we expected to find several
very pretty scenes with which to put the camera through its paces.
And so we did...
The Abingdon section of the Creeper Trail passes right through the
middle of a huge horse farm, and there were several horses and young
foals grazing in the pasture fields on both sides of us as we passed
through. One horse in particular caught Tami's eye as it dined on a
bale of hay resting under a large tree. She asked Cheria to take a
picture of it, and she did even though it was quite some distance
away from us. The result was the wonderful silhouette featured in
today's picture.
Although it's a lot different from her trusty old Kodak Z7590, we're
very pleased with Cheria's new Powershot S3 IS. Thanks to image
stabilization, she is able to hand-hold the Canon and still use its 12X
zoom lens to "reach out" and capture scenes that would have required
a tripod in order to avoid blurring with the Kodak. We have found it
to be a very nice camera that takes pictures that rival those from
my low-end Nikon digital SLR! Of course it helps to have spectacular
scenery to photograph, and we always find plenty of it waiting for
us every time we go for a walk on the Virginia Creeper Trail!
